this might be a dumb question but what the heck!

my friend said he would give me his rims for free, i dont remember what brand they were but they are aftermarket. they are made from his 99 M3, would they fit my 04? would i have to get spacers? they are 18's by the way and there gunmetal.

Postby rollaevo99 » Tue May 09, 2006 2:18 pm

as far as I know BMW's bolt patterns are 5x120.......our rides has 5x114.3

Postby Jon11582 » Tue May 09, 2006 2:18 pm

I think the M's rims are way too wide, and I think they are also staggered.

Not to mention the offset, (I think the M3's have really low offset)
